Abstract (English): Today, there are many tools for object-relational mapping, and given that fact, you need to decide which tool to choose. This problem is the purpose of writing this paper. Clearly, the Entity and Entity Core frameworks are the most popular object-relational mapping tools in C # programming language. However, there are other good tools that can match them. The paper analyzes and compares the support for object-relational mapping and performance of the Entity Core framework, which is very relevant today in .NET applications, and NHibernate, which is a .NET version of the popular ORM tool of the Java programming language, Hibernate. Time and allocated memory are selected as metrics in this paper. The BenchmarkDotNet library was used to measure time and memory. The performance of loading, writing, modifying and deleting records from the database were measured. The aim of this paper is a comparative analysis of object-relational mapping of Entity Core and NHibernate framework, examination of Entity Core and NHibernate framework performance. Abstract (Bosnian): Danas postoji dosta alata za objektno-relaciono preslikavanje i s obzirom na tu činjenicu, treba doneti odluku koji alat odabrati. Upravo je ovaj problem svrha pisanja ovog rada. Jasno je da su Entity i Entity Core okviri najpopularniji alati za objektno-relaciono preslikavanje kada je reč o C# programskom jeziku. Međutim, postoji još dobrih alata koji mogu da im pariraju. Rad analizira i poredi podršku za objektno-relaciono preslikavanje i performanse Entity Core okvira koji je danas veoma aktuelan kod .NET aplikacija, i NHibernate koji je .NET verzija popularnog ORM alata Java programskog jezika, Hibernate. Kao metrike u ovom radu odabrane su vreme i alocirana memorija. Za merenje vremena i memorije korišćena je BenchmarkDotNet biblioteka. Merene su performanse učitavanja, upisivanja, izmene i brisanja rekorda iz baze podataka. Cilj rada je uporedna analiza objektno-relacionog preslikavanja Entity Core i NHibernate okvira, ispitivanje performansi Entity Core i NHibernate okvira. [ABSTRACT FROM AUTHOR]
